Executable (.EXE or .DLL) |
Location |
Description |
BROWSE.EXE |
Server Controller |
Advantage Database Table viewer |
CENTRALREPOSITORY.EXE |
Server Controller |
.NET WPF application that communicates to the RSDK Central Repository Server (MS SQL) |
CNALERT.EXE |
Remote Server |
True Windows Service of MTALERT. Alert system managers via email when certain events occur. |
CNFEVER.EXE |
Client App |
Front End Voice Recognition called from MTLOGIN. This will download the user files and call RSDFEVER (.NET) |
CNHL7.EXE |
Remote Server |
True Windows Service of MTHL7. Handles all HL7 inbound and outbound interfaces. Creates an instance of MTHL7PROC for each HL7 profile that is defined. Uses standard HL7 socket-to-socket protocol as defined in the ANSI standard. |
CNHL7PROC.DLL |
Remote Server |
HL7 socket-to-socket communications program. This is a DLL application that gets created by CNHL7 for each HL7 profile defined. It will create a new DLL for each instance needed, up to 5 instances. Typically, one instance will handle inbound ADT transactions, and another instance will handle outbound HL7 results (reports). |
CNREMDIST.EXE |
Remote Server |
True Windows Service of MREMDIST. Handles distribution of reports that are distributed by remote location devices, including printing reports to any remote printer, printing reports to the patient location (nursing unit), creating outbound Word or RTF documents, or creating HL7 results files. |
CNREPORTS.DLL |
Host Server |
.NET Application. This is the engine for the "New" style of reports. |
CNRW.EXE |
Host Server |
.NET Application. This is the Front end GUI for the "New" style of reports. This gets called from MTREQSVR |
CONCORDVIEWER.EXE |
Client App |
Called from MTCLIENT when viewing the history of a document. If the document is a Concord XML, This application is called because there is not a Delphi API. |
CV6SOLO.EXE |
Client App |
ChartVox Solo. The application for PC-based dictation using a Philips SpeechMike. Dictated audio jobs are then uploaded to ChartNet via MTSOLO. |
FINDACTIVEX.EXE |
Host Server |
Used to show the registered ActiveX modules. Mainly for MTREQSVR and MTREPTSVR. |
INSTALLRSDK.EXE |
Client App |
.NET application used to install the required files for RSDK on the client. Needed for RSDFEVER and RSDEDITOR |
MTALERT.EXE |
Server Controller |
Alert system managers via email when certain events occur. |
MTAUTH.EXE |
Client App |
This programs purpose is to allow maintenance of an Authors file (used by MTRDR) that is shared among multiple sites. The command line must have the following parameter: /AuthorPath=[path] |
MTBACKUP.EXE |
Server Controller |
Nightly system backup utility. Uses the Advantage Database built-in functions to do either a full backup, or differential backup. |
MTCCSVR.EXE |
Server Controller |
Manages the interfacing to the Concord servers for voice recognition. Handles requests from MTVRSVR and then, depending on the type of request, will launch a .NET program (MTCONCORD) to service the request via web service calls to Concord. Creates response files to let MTVRSVR know the status of the request. |
MTCDA2WORD.EXE |
Host Server |
Converts MModal CDA (XML) documents to RTF documents for storage in ChartNet. This process is called "rendering" and requires the use of the AnyModal Publish software supplied by M*Modal. Typically, MTCDA2WORD runs on a separate server. Multiple servers can be configured for high volume situations. |
MTCEDITOR.EXE |
Client App |
.Net application. Called by MTCLIENT to edit Concord based documents. |
MTCLIENT.EXE |
Client App |
ChartNet Client Console. The main application for accessing ChartNet. It gets launched via MTLogin, then creates an instance of MTVClient. |
MTCONCORD.EXE |
Server Controller |
Application called by MTCCSVR to send and receive files and requests to/from the Concord Server. |
MTCONCORD2RTF.EXE |
Server Controller |
Converts Concord XML documents to RTF documents for storage in ChartNet. This process is called "rendering". Typically, MTCONCORD3RTF runs on a separate server. |
MTCONFIG.EXE |
Host Server |
Used for creating and editing program configuration profiles. Called from Service Controller to configure tables |
MTCTRL.EXE |
Server Controller |
Service Controller. This application is responsible for launching all of the other backend applications and monitoring them for possible crashes. Will restart crashed programs. |
MTDISTRIB.EXE |
Server Controller |
Manages all report distribution. Launches two instances of MTREPTSVR, one for distribution requiring printing and one for non-printing distributions. If a separate server is required for doing printing, then MTDISTRIB can launch MTREPTSVR using DCOM. |
MTFAX.EXE |
Server Controller |
The main fax scheduler. Handles requests coming in from MTSNDFAX clients. |
MTFTP.EXE |
Server Controller |
FTP client application used for sending and receiving files. Only used in situations that cannot be handled via the normal methods of getting data in and out of ChartNet. |
MTGETDOCUMENT.EXE |
|
Gets draft documents back from M*Modal. This is a .NET program called by MTMMSVR via requests made by MTVRSVR. |
MTHL7.EXE |
Remote Server |
Handles all HL7 inbound and outbound interfaces. Creates an instance of MTHL7PROC for each HL7 profile that is defined. Uses standard HL7 socket-to-socket protocol as defined in the ANSI standard. |
MTHL7PROC.EXE |
Remote Server |
HL7 socket-to-socket communications program. This is a COM automation controller application that gets created by MTHL7 for each HL7 profile defined. Typically, one instance will handle inbound ADT transactions, and another instance will handle outbound HL7 results (reports). |
MTINI.EXE |
Host Server |
General purpose INI file manager. Uses the PARAMS.ADT file to know what fields to capture for any given INI file. |
MTLOGIN.EXE |
Client App |
The front end program that authenticates the user's login, checks for software updates, and launches MTCLIENT or CV6Solo. It gets installed via an InstallShield setup program that is downloaded from the ChartNet web site. |
MTLOGV.EXE |
Host Server |
ChartNet Log Viewer. General purpose tool for displaying and searching log files generated by other ChartNet programs. |
MTMMSVR.EXE |
Server Controller |
Manages the interfacing to the M*Modal servers for voice recognition. Handles requests from MTVRSVR and then, depending on the type of request, will launch one of the .NET programs to service the request via web service calls to M*Modal. Creates response files to let MTVRSVR know the status of the request. |
MTMPI.EXE |
Server Controller |
Imports patient demographic data ("ADT" data) into a site's Master Patient Index (MPI) table. Can handle files in the HL7 format or other standard or custom formats. |
MTORDER.EXE |
Server Controller |
Imports orders data into a site's Orders table. Can handle files in the HL7 format or other standard formats. Mostly used for Radiology orders. |
MTPLAY.EXE |
Client App |
ChartNet Voice Player. Used for playback of audio files. This is a COM automation controller application that is controlled by MTVClient. |
MTPLAYAES.EXE |
Client App |
ChartNet Encryption Voice Player. Used for playback of audio files that are encrypted and not encrypted. This is a COM automation controller application that is controlled by MTVClient, |
MTPTLOC.EXE |
Server Controller |
Handles printing to patient location printers. Uses the site's Master Patient Index to determine where the patient resides, then selects the appropriate printer to print to. Hands the actual printing over to MTDISTRIB. |
MTPURGE.EXE |
Server Controller |
Used for purging data from various tables. Can be scheduled to run nightly or weekly |
MTRDR.EXE |
Client App |
Handles downloading and transmission of voice files captured by Olympus hand-held voice recorders. This application is typically installed on the physician workstation. Uses SendFiles to send the voice files to the server. |
MTRECV.EXE |
Server Controller |
Used for processing files received by MTFTP. Will unzip and decrypt files if required. Used to process Voice Reader (MTRDR) files sent in. |
MTREMDIST.EXE |
Remote Server |
Handles distribution of reports that are distributed by remote location devices, including printing reports to any remote printer, printing reports to the patient location (nursing unit), creating outbound Word or RTF documents, or creating HL7 results files. |
MTRENDER.EXE |
Server Controller |
Manages the M*Modal rendering process. Creates requests that are handled by the first available MTCDA2WORD program. After MTCDA2WORD finishes rendering the XML document into an RTF file, it creates a response file telling MTRENDER the success or failure of the request. If successful, MTRENDER imports the RTF document file into the ChartNet database, then determines the next workflow. Each rendering server requires Word 2007 installed. Only run one instance of MTCDA2WORD on a given server. Can have multiple rendering servers. |
MTREPIMP.EXE |
Server Controller |
Imports externally created reports into ChartNet. Files must be in RTF of DOC format. Document files must have a "header" section at the top that specifies the patient demographic fields, or you can use an .INI file to do this. |
MTREPTSVR.EXE |
Server Controller |
Handles distribution of reports. This is a COM automation server application that is instantiated by MTDISTRIB. |
MTREQSVR.EXE.EXE |
Web Server |
ChartNet Request Server. This is a COM automation controller application that takes requests (in XML format) from MTWEBSVR, processes the request, then creates an XML response string to pass back to the client via MTWEBSVR. The XML response contains fields indicating the success or failure of the request, as well as data fields that the client requested. Depending on the type of request, a list of files to download will be included in the XML response string. |
MTRFEDIT.EXE |
Host Server |
RSDK Rendering Format Editor |
MTRSDHELPER.EXE |
Client App |
A helper application for MTCEditor.exe (Concord). This application helps the Concord Editor with communication to the host server. |
MTSCHED.EXE |
Server Controller |
Imports patient schedule data ("SUI" data) into a site's Schedule table. Can handle files in the HL7 format only. |
MTSETUP.EXE |
Host Server |
Used for initial set up of a host and remote servers. Normally only run by ChartNet Technology. |
MTSNDFAX.EXE |
Remote Server |
Sends reports via fax. Multiple instances of the program can be configured, each instance handling a specific fax modem. |
MTSOFT.EXE |
Host Server |
Handles the initial installation of ChartNet software as well as software updates. |
MTSRCH.EXE |
Host Server |
Host-only application for report searching and doing "batch" operations on the search results. For example batch distribution of reports. |
MTSTARTSTOP.EXE |
Host Server |
Used to Set the System Down flag and shut down ADS Server. All programs must be closed prior to using this. It will also clear the flag. |
MTSTRUCT.EXE |
Host Server |
Checks all ChartNet tables for proper record structure and indexes. Will restructure and/or reindex tables as required. Normally this is only run after a major software update. Can be launched directly from MTSOFT. |
MTSUBMITJOB.EXE |
Server Controller |
Submits audio jobs to MModal. This is a .NET program that is launched by MTMMSVR via a request made by MTVRSVR. |
MTSUBMITREVIEWED.EXE |
Server Controller |
Submits edited reports back to MModal for further voice recognition training. This is a .NET program that is launched by MTMMSVR via a request from MTVRSVR. |
MTUPDATE.EXE |
Server Controller |
Updates the STATS table as reports are sent back to the system. Also is responsible for routine maintenance of certain files as well as updates to other statistical tables. |
MTUPLOAD.EXE |
Remote Server |
Used for uploading data from a remote server to the host server. Audio files, HL7 ADT transactions, and order transactions are examples of data files that can be uploaded to the host server for import into ChartNet. |
MTUTILS.EXE |
Host Server |
System Utilities. Contains various options for handling special situations. |
MTVCLIENT.EXE |
Client App |
ChartNet Voice Client. The application used for downloading and managing audio files on the user's workstation. This is a COM automation controller application that is launched by MTClient. This program also creates an instance of MTPlay to playback audio files. |
MTVCONVERT.EXE |
Host Server |
DS2 to WAV convertor |
MTVIMP.EXE |
Server Controller |
Handles importing of audio files into ChartNet. This program is also responsible for determining whether or not audio jobs are to be sent to M*Modal for voice recognition processing. |
MTVRSVR.EXE |
Server Controller |
Voice recognition manager. Interfaces with MTMMSVR for sending and receiving data to MModal. Uses a simple "request" and "response" file technique for communicating to MTMMSVR, MTRSDSVR, and MTCCSVR. |
MTVRTRAIN.EXE |
Server Controller |
Batch voice recognition training. Handles sending legacy audio files to Mmodal for training new speakers. Normally, new speakers are trained in real-time by sending jobs to M*Modal as they arrive in ChartNet. This program allows you to jump start the process by sending over old audio files for training. |
MTWEBSVR.DLL |
Web Server |
The front end to the Request Server (mtreqsvr). This is an ISAPI application that handles all requests from remote client applications, such as MTCLIENT. Requests come in as an XML message, get handed off to the next available MTREQSVR application. Once the request is fulfilled, and XML response is created by MTREQSVR then handed back to MTWEBSVR, which then passes it back to the client application. |
RSDFEVER.EXE |
Client App |
.NET application for Front End Voice Recognition using Recognosco API. |
RUNWORDMACRO.EXE |
Host Server |
.NET application used to fix numbering issues with Mmodal documents after they are rendered. |
SENDFILES |
Remote Server / Client App |
Used to send files to the host. |